Action item from the Mistgrove token incident: the refresh worker was racing the expiry check, so a handful of users got bounced mid-session whenever the clock skewed past the grace window. Fix is merged — we now refresh early and tolerate modest skew — but the release needs the new constants baked in before the Thursday train, not hot-patched after. Heads up that rollback reverts to the old racy values, so flag it in the notes. The shipped values are these.

tuning table, yajog-yahof:
BUDGETS = {
    "lamvan": 303,
    "wenox": 460,
    "fenvan": 525,
}

## Account Recovery — Pool Reset (Plugin Authors)

If a recovery flow stalls, your plugin is likely holding stale connections from the Fernwick pool. Call `pool.drain()` before retrying, cap retries at three, and never open direct connections during recovery. After the drain completes, re-auth using the operator recovery passphrase shown below.

strongbox words: zordor-quenax

Ticket: Encoding detection drift on upload service

Support team: several customers report uploaded text files being mangled to replacement characters. Root cause is configuration drift — the Textwright staging values leaked onto two production nodes, lowering the detection confidence threshold. Affected nodes have been cordoned. Until the fleet is reconciled, verify any suspect node is running with the following configuration values.

settings of bawif-fawif:
ralix:
  log_level: warn
  metrics_host: metrics.ralix.tolvaqsys.internal
  pool_size: 32

The Orvane Labs bike cage and the east and west parking gates operate on separate access schedules, and facilities desk staff should note that visitor vehicles may only use the west gate between 07:00 and 19:00. Cyclists requesting cage access must show a valid day pass, and their details should be entered in the access ledger before the cage is opened. Gates must never be propped open, even briefly, during deliveries. When a manual override is required at either gate, use the code below.

staff pass of fadup-fawig = bdg-FUNKS-4